I’ve always celebrated Valentine’s day as long as I can remember. It is my absolute favorite holiday. It didn’t matter if I didn’t have a boyfriend or if I was dating someone who cared enough to acknowledge it with me (I lived and learned!). Anyway, in 2007 as a single girl, I spent the day at a Single’s Mingle with my roommate at the time and my current roommate Brandi. After, I went home and baked Valentine’s cookies! The thing is, it ended up being a Vday misadventure. Read further to see. As taken from my xanga on February 14, 2007.

After my Roomie, Brandi and I mingled at a single’s mingle tonight (very fun by the way), we decided to end Valentine on a sweet and cute note by making those ready-to-bake sugar cookies. They were so so cute in the package I decided to take a picture of it. Still in it’s wax-paper package.

I lined the cookie sheet with wax paper instead of cookie paper. Roomie walked by and paused. “Linda, you sure wax paper is okay to bake?” I thought to myself a little. “Hmm. You’re right. Wax melts. Not good.”

Roomie read the box.. and here’s another phone camera picture. In case you can’t read it since it is poor quality, says “good for lining pans for baking.” or some shit like that.

5 minutes of the 8, things got a bit smoky in our apartment. Wax paper BAD idea. I acted without thinking and just pulled the wax paper out from under the undercooked cookies.

:( broken hearts.

We tried to fix them…

We couldn’t stop laughing…

We put the best looking ones on top.

This post still makes me giggle. This year, I’ve decided to relive this memory. I bought TWO packages of these same very cookies. You know, to account for any possible missteps.
